What to Consider When Choosing an Oven
Picking the best oven includes more than simply picking a brand name and design. Here are substantial aspects to keep in mind:
Type of Oven:
- Wall ovens uk: These are built into the wall and conserve space. They are ideal for little kitchens.
- Freestanding Ovens: These ovens include an integrated cooktop and deal versatility in positioning.
- Double Ovens: For passionate bakers and chefs, double ovens enable simultaneous cooking at different temperatures.
Fuel Type:
- Electric: Typically provides a more even cooking temperature, often preferred for baking.
- Gas: Offers immediate heat and more control over cooking temperatures, preferred by many professional chefs.
- Convection: These ovens have fans that distribute hot air, reducing cooking time and ensuring even baking.
Size Matters:
- Standard oven sizes normally fit within 30 inches of area, however it is important to measure your kitchen to ensure a correct fit.
Functions:
- Self-Cleaning: Saves time and effort in upkeep.
- Smart Technology: Allows for best oven remote access and monitoring from a mobile phone app.
- Multiple Cooking Modes: Different settings for baking, broiling, and roasting.

What to Consider When Choosing a Hob
Picking the ideal hob is equally essential as picking an oven. The hob is where most cooking starts, and its performance can substantially affect cooking efficiency. Here are the main aspects to think about:
Type of Hob:
- Gas Hobs: Offer fast heat and immediate flame response, suitable for professionals.
- Electric Induction Hobs: Use electro-magnetic fields to heat pots and pans directly. They are more energy-efficient and much safer, as they do not warm up the surface.
- Ceramic hobs and ovens: Feature smooth glass surfaces and are easy to tidy however can take longer to heat.
Size and Configuration:
- Hobs been available in various sizes, typically 30 inches. You can discover designs with different burner configurations to fit your cooking style, such as a mix of large and little burners.
Safety Features:
- Look for hobs with features like kid locks, car shut-off, and residual heat signs if security is an issue.
Control Type:
- Choose in between knob controls for traditionalists or touch controls for best oven modern visual appeals and ease of cleaning.

Regularly Asked Questions
1. What is the distinction between convection and standard ovens?
Convection ovens have a fan that distributes hot air, leading to quicker and more uniformly cooked food. Conventional ovens rely entirely on the heating aspects.

2. Are induction hobs safer than gas hobs?
Yes, induction hobs just heat the cookware and not the surface, minimizing the threat of burns. They likewise switch off immediately when pots and pans is removed.
3. Can I convert a gas oven to electric?
While it's possible, it usually involves substantial modifications to the kitchen's gas lines, making it less recommended.
4. What are the benefits of wise ovens?
Smart ovens permit convenient remote cooking, preheating, and monitoring through a smart device, which can enhance your cooking experience.
5. How do I clean a self-cleaning oven?
The majority of self-cleaning ovens run by warming up to a very high temperature level to burn food residues. Merely wipe tidy after the cycle completes.
